Results of a new poll conducted by Elon University were released on April 14. Participants from North Carolina were asked, who they would give their vote to, if the election were today. The results show that 47.0% of participants will vote for the democrat Hillary Clinton, whereas 41.0% said they would vote for the republican Donald Trump. The poll was carried out from February 15 to February 17 among 1530 likely voters. The sampling error is +/-2.5 points.

Translating these results into two-party vote shares yields values of 53.4% for the Democrats and 46.6% for the Republicans. The republicans did better by 2.3 percentage points in comparison to the average results of the other polls in North Carolina.
